Lisbon Architecture Triennale in Lisbon

The Lisbon Architecture Triennale is a major international exhibition examining contemporary architecture and urbanism, staged across galleries and public spaces in the city roughly every three years since its founding in 2007. Exact dates for the next edition had not yet been announced as of the source check.
